About this map

Wells Bench and Eureka Ridge dominate the landscape in this late 1960s survey, where high plateaus overlook the emerging Dworshak Reservoir. The map records a moment of transition as the North Fork Clearwater River valley began its transformation into a large-scale reservoir system. Scattered rural settlements like Dent, Reggear, and Morris are documented alongside specialized local nodes such as Best Corner. Genealogists will find notable value in the location of the Wells Cem and Weseman Cem, which sit near the Nez Perce Indian Reservation Boundary. The presence of several Gravel Pits and a Trailer Park near the reservoir's edge suggests the industrial and residential activity accompanying the massive hydrological changes of this era.
